Streaming Services: Watch the Game on the Go
In today’s digital age, streaming services offer unparalleled convenience for sports fans. Guys, you have a ton of options when it comes to streaming the Chiefs vs. Giants game. Major streaming platforms like Paramount+, Peacock, ESPN+, and FuboTV often carry NFL games, allowing you to watch on your smart TV, phone, tablet, or computer. This means you can catch all the action from anywhere, whether you're at home, at a coffee shop, or even on the go. The accessibility of these services is a huge plus, especially for those with busy schedules. To make sure you can watch, you'll need to subscribe to a service that has the rights to broadcast the game. You can usually find information about which streaming services have the rights by checking the NFL's official website or your favorite sports news sites. Many of these services also offer free trials, so you could potentially watch the game without paying. Always read the fine print and check the terms of service to avoid any unexpected charges. Streaming services usually provide high-definition quality, and some even offer extra features like multiple camera angles and in-game stats. The ability to pause, rewind, and rewatch key moments is another major advantage. Plus, you can watch on your favorite devices, so you're not tied to your living room TV. This flexibility is a game-changer for modern sports fans. Just make sure you have a stable internet connection to avoid buffering issues.
Now, let's talk specifics. Paramount+ is a great choice because it is a streaming service that often carries CBS broadcasts, which frequently include NFL games. Peacock might also broadcast NFL games, especially those on NBC. ESPN+ and FuboTV are also great choices. FuboTV is particularly known for its extensive sports coverage, and it typically includes major networks that broadcast NFL games. YouTube TV is also a great option, as it includes many of the major networks. Subscription costs vary between services, so it's a good idea to compare prices and features to find the one that best suits your needs and budget. Before subscribing, check their official website for game availability. Also, ensure your devices are compatible with the streaming service you choose. NFL Official Platforms: Direct Access to the Action
If you're a die-hard NFL fan, the league itself offers some fantastic options for watching games. The NFL+ service provides live access to local and primetime games on your phone and tablet. This is an excellent way to catch the Chiefs vs. Giants game if you're always on the move. Please note that, while this service does provide great mobile viewing, it may not offer live games on your TV. The NFL also has partnerships with other streaming services, so you might be able to watch games through those platforms. Keep an eye on the NFL's official website and social media channels for announcements about game availability and any special offers. You'll find detailed information on how to watch the game on various devices, including phones, tablets, and connected TVs. Additionally, the NFL app often provides game highlights, scores, and other exclusive content. The app is a great resource for all things NFL, keeping you up-to-date with the latest news and stats. Following the official NFL platforms ensures you get the most accurate and up-to-date information. You'll also find exclusive content, such as behind-the-scenes footage and interviews with players. Moreover, the NFL website and app are reliable sources for schedules, standings, and other game-related information. Make sure to check these platforms for the latest updates on game broadcasts and streaming options. You will never miss a play!
Moreover, the NFL Game Pass, formerly known as NFL Sunday Ticket, is another premium option to consider, although it may have changed providers or availability. Check to see if it is still available for the upcoming season. This service typically provides access to every out-of-market game, which is a huge advantage if you are a fan of multiple teams or if you live in an area where the game isn't locally broadcast.
